I have lived here for almost a year now. I actually live in what Rancho calls an "efficiency" but I have a full kitchen a large window, and about 300 square feet of floor space, so, not too shabby. Not to mention the fact they take FANTASTIC care of the place. The grounds are full of trees and plants, and a man-made creek that really adds to the tranquility of the place. The pool is BEAUTIFUL, and cleaned on a regular basis, as is everything here. Any time I have had a problem, my calls are returned the same day, by 6pm, or the following morning, and That's just the office. I had a random noise problem, called the security guard, and he took care of it, within ten minutes!! I am a gym rat, and the fitness center here gets nice. Can't beat good equipment, water, and two cable TV's. Oh yeah, and they have coffee, tea, and cookies in the office EVERY SINGLE DAY! It's almost bizarre how much the mgmt cares about the place. Love it. I feel safe, and suggest anyone new to LA check this place out. Upon move in, I was also welcomes with a $25 gift certficate to Target. Not much, but way more than I expected. PS: They don't offer parking for "efficiencies," but the neighborhood behind the complex is super easy to find spots in. I haven't had any problems. There's parking for studios and all other apartments.

Moved to this apartment as a recently married couple. Both my partner and I love the tranquility and natural landscape of the area. The downside of the place is that the parking slots are too narrow for large vehicles and the lack of elevators for handicap individuals.
